Rock types and mineralization characteristics.From the analysis of well logging , core , slice data of Lun 1 , Lun 2 , Lun 3 , Lun 4 , Lun 5, the main rock types include:Multi-composition sandy conglomerate; gravel–bearing sandstone ;conglomerate limestone,lithic sandstone, gray quartz–siltstone grip sparry limestone and so on.The content of quartz in mineral detritus is high , the average contents of it in fine,slit quartz-stone is 70% and low feldspar content.The contents of detritus is high ,it is about 60% in sandy conglomerate ,and types complex .Volcanic debris and limy dolomite are main contents, fine–siltstones are followly,these feature reflect rapid subsidence and near–shore sedimentary environment.Cement and argillaceous matrix are the mainly form of interstitial material .The mainly cement is calcite and few kaolinite.
Sandly conglomerate is the main components in target bed of Niubao Formation and Dinqing lake formation .Particle size coarse,well mechanical compaction resistance and the compaction is showde by the rupture of clastic grain along the weakness structure plane of its surface, microfissure and filled with other interstitial material . 2, Pressure solution While in Sandstone ,the content of feldspar , debris and other fragile components is high .Besides it , the poor ability of resist—compaction caused by low structure maturity, compaction often associated with pressolution and it showed in Fig.1,Point—line contact and concave convex contact are the main contact between grains ,besides it some pores are inserted or pierced by coarse grains .It makes great impact on the reservoir decrease when the plastic materials deformation or intersection Fig.1 The core of Well A in plane polarized light 3.Cementation The temperature and pressure is rise whith the increase buried depth of reservoirs
